Abstract

A spinal deformity correcting instrument is made of shape memory alloy capable of being implanted into the spinal column of a human body, and comprises a hook, universal heads and longitudinal bars. The universal heads and the hook are integrated, the universal heads on two sides of the hook are respectively arranged on a left shoulder and a right shoulder of the hook and are hollow cylinders, U-shaped grooves are arranged on the cylinders, and threads are arranged on inner side surfaces of the U-shaped grooves; the longitudinal bars are solid cylinders and are fixedly placed in the U-shaped grooves of the universal heads, and diameters of the longitudinal bars are matched with sizes of the U-shaped grooves arranged on the universal heads; and the hook is arched, bent hooks are arranged at two ends of the hook, and a longitudinal groove is arranged on the arched top of the hook. During usage, a doctor can operate the spinal deformity correcting instrument on a transverse process or vertebral plate without implanting a pedicle screw into the human body or opening the spinal canal of the human body, advantages of the bent hooks, the longitudinal bars and the universal heads which are made of the memory alloy can be sufficiently played, complicated surgical operation is simplified, surgical risks are greatly reduced, and the spinal deformity correcting instrument can be widely applied to various spinal deformity correcting surgeries and can be easily popularized in primary hospitals.

Background technology
Deformity of spine is the common and frequently-occurring disease of a class, caused by many reasons, can be single or multiple and deposit lateral bending, rotation, front or rear protruding deformity, the form such as stiff of showing as, each age group all can be fallen ill, especially be apt to occur in child and teenager, not only affect outward appearance, the more important thing is functions such as very easily threatening the heart, lung, nervous system, the serious harm people are physically and mentally healthy.Suitable most client need operation correction deformity.

Above-mentioned disclosed document can solve some problems of deformity of spine, and the shortcoming that still exists is that the rectification effect that has is undesirable, the complex structure that has, and complicated operation, practicality is not strong, and what really should use is few.To sum up, it is the process of gradual perfection that the orthotics of the deformity of spine that emerges in an endless stream develops into pedicle nail bar system popular outside the Now Domestic from Ha Shi, Lu Shi rod, yet the defective of its technology is apparent, and the former gets loose by apparatus easily, and latter's operation technique is complicated, it need to insert pedicle nail, often need to open canalis spinalis, osteotomy is orthopedic, technical merit and experience is required high, operation risk is large, cause easily the severe complications such as paraplegia, therefore be difficult to promote the use to basic hospital.
Summary of the invention
Purpose of the present invention is exactly the deficiency that overcomes existing orthotics, and provides brand-new a kind of formation take memorial alloy as material to be exclusively used in the apparatus that deformity of spine is corrected.
The present invention is achieved through the following technical solutions:
A kind of deformity of spine orthotics, it is characterized in that: this apparatus is to be made by marmem that can the implant into body spinal column, it comprises coupler body, Universal-head and vertical rod, described Universal-head and coupler body are an integral body, the both sides Universal-head is separately positioned on the left and right sides shoulder of coupler body, Universal-head is hollow cylinder, and cylinder has U-lag, and the medial surface of U-lag is provided with screw thread; Described vertical rod is a solid cylinder, and vertical rod is placed in the U-shaped groove of Universal-head, and the set U-lag of the diameter of barred body and Universal-head matches, and is fixed by bolt; Being shaped as of described coupler body is arc, and the two ends of coupler body are provided with crotch, and the center below the arch roof of coupler body is provided with a longitudinal fluting.
Described longitudinal fluting effect is to be convenient to bending with the coupling required size of patient and can to make bending concentrate on the coupler body groove, thereby does not affect the structure at other positions.
The direction of the crotch at above-described coupler body two ends is the symmetric form shape.
The direction of the crotch at described coupler body two ends is the asymmetric shape in left side.
The direction of the crotch at described coupler body two ends is the asymmetric shape in right side.
The length of described vertical rod matches for the lopsided spine lengths that needs to correct.
Above-described deformity of spine orthotics, described coupler body are several, and vertical rod matches with the U-shaped groove of each coupler body Universal-head, and series connection is integrated.That the lopsided spinal column of correcting is as required settled several coupler bodies during use, to indulge the cooling of rod and coupler body, curve required form, be buckled in spinal column both sides transverse process or vertebral plate after crotch opens, the rewarming palintrope hooks clasp and embraces and be difficult for getting loose, and will indulge in the U-shaped groove of Universal-head that rod is installed in several coupler bodies again, and by the locking of bolt appropriateness, consist of the three-dimensional correction structure, can recover strong behind the vertical excellent rewarming, can progressively correct lopsided spinal column as required.
Described marmem be can implant into body Nickel-titanium alloy for medical purpose, the weight ratio of Ti: Ni is 1: 1-1.5 can also add other element, such as copper, aluminum and zinc etc. as required in right amount.

Application Example
Application Example 1, Zheng, the Tiandong County, Guangxi, the student, the woman, 14 years old, because of idiopathic scoliosis deformity, cure that effect is bad for many years, have a strong impact on outward appearance and the heart, pulmonary function, through the apparatus that deformity of spine of the present invention on probation is corrected, Operation correction deformity.The 3 months after operation recovery from illness, outward appearance is obviously improved, and the heart, pulmonary function recover.Follow-up After 2 years half, check fixedly gets loose and the generation of the related complication such as orthopedic loss angle without interior.
Application Example 2, deep certain, the City: A Case Study in Baise people, the man, 39 years old, because traffic accident causes lumbar-thoracic spine fracture kyphosis deformity and not exclusively paralysis, expectant treatment can not recover, the difficulty of taking care of oneself, through the apparatus that deformity of spine of the present invention on probation is corrected, Operation is corrected, and fully recovers after 3 months, life can take care of oneself, and can recover normal operation after half a year.Follow-up After 4 years half, union of fracture, check fixedly gets loose and the generation of the complication such as orthopedic loss angle without interior.
Application Example 3, Zhang, the Nanning company personnel, man, 27 years old, because of the serious tetanic deformity of ankylosing spondylitis spinal column, patient is bow-backed, has a strong impact on work and life, through the apparatus of deformity of spine rectification of the present invention on probation, the orthopedic recovery spinal column of Operation physiological camber, clinical symptoms is satisfied with improves effect.Follow-up After 6 years check does not have interior fixedly getting loose and the complication such as orthopedic loss angle.
